C语言char数组复制的方法是什么

在C语言中,可以使用strcpy函数来复制一个char数组。strcpy函数的原型如下:char *strcpy(char *dest, const char *src);其中,dest是目标数组,src是源数组。示例代码如下:#include #include int main() {char src[10] = “Hello”;char dest[1

在C语言中,可以使用strcpy函数来复制一个char数组。strcpy函数的原型如下:

char *strcpy(char *dest, const char *src);

其中,dest是目标数组,src是源数组。示例代码如下:

#include <stdio.h>
#include <string.h>

int main() {
    char src[10] = "Hello";
    char dest[10];

    strcpy(dest, src);

    printf("Copied string is: %s\n", dest);

    return 0;
}

上面的代码中,我们首先定义了两个char数组src和dest,然后使用strcpy函数将src中的字符串复制到dest中。最后打印出复制后的字符串。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至 55@qq.com 举报,一经查实,本站将立刻删除。转转请注明出处:https://www.szhjjp.com/n/1046995.html

(0)
派派
上一篇 2024-05-26
下一篇 2024-05-26

相关推荐

  • Phi-3模型在知识图谱构建和查询方面的能力怎么样

    Phi-3模型是基于深度学习技术的知识图谱表示学习模型,具有以下优势和能力:知识图谱构建能力:Phi-3模型可以从大规模文本数据中学习知识图谱的结构和关系,自动构建知识图谱。它可以识别实体、属性和关系,并将它们表示成向量形式,从而构建出具有丰富语义信息的知识图谱。知识图谱查询能力:Phi-3模型可以对知识图谱中的实体、属性和关系进行查询,并根据查询条件返回相应的结果。它可以通过学习知识图谱的表示向

    2024-05-24
    0
  • 迪兰RX 6800 16G X战神评测跑分参数介绍

    迪兰RX 6800 16G X战神相比于xt版区别主要是不支持超频以及性能略微的下降,但是依旧是6000系列中的次旗舰产品,那么它在实际的游戏测试中表现如何呢,可以参考下面的评测跑分参数介绍来了解。【amd显卡天梯图】【显卡天梯图】迪兰RX 6800 16G X战神显卡评测:1、作为rx6000系列次旗舰,虽然它不支持xt的超频,但是依旧能够使用amd的帧数优化技术。2、在游戏测试中,《古墓丽影:

    2024-02-03 技术经验
    0
  • c语言数组如何增加元素

    在C语言中,数组的大小一旦确定就无法直接增加元素。如果需要增加元素,通常的做法是创建一个新的更大尺寸的数组,然后将旧数组中的元素复制到新数组中。以下是一种增加元素的方法:#include #include int main() {int oldArray[] = {1, 2, 3, 4, 5};int newSize = 6;int *newArray

    2024-05-23
    0
  • ntuser.dat文件可不可以删除详情介绍

    对于“NTUSER.DAT”这个文件,许多人都并不清楚其具体含义以及是否能够进行删减操作。因此,我们特地为您准备了关于“NTUSER.DAT”文件的详细解读,希望能解答您的疑问并提供帮助。ntuser.dat是什么文件可以删除吗:答:ntuser.dat是Windows 2000/XP的注册表文件之一,是可以删的。它包含着用户特定的数据,是用户配置文件之一。所以在没有必要的情况下还是不建议删除的。

    2024-02-28
    0
  • ubuntu安装软件的方法是什么

    在Ubuntu上安装软件有多种方法,以下是常见的几种方法:使用命令行安装:在终端中使用apt-get或apt命令来安装软件。例如,要安装Firefox浏览器,可以运行命令sudo apt-get install firefox。使用Ubuntu软件中心:Ubuntu系统自带了一个图形化的软件中心,可以直接搜索并安装软件。打开Ubuntu软件中心,在搜索框中输入要安装的软件名称,然后点击安装按钮即可

    2024-01-23
    0
  • MATLAB中的异常处理机制怎么使用

    在MATLAB中,可以使用try-catch块来捕获和处理异常。try块中包含可能会引发异常的代码,catch块中包含处理异常的代码。在catch块中可以指定要捕获的异常类型,也可以使用MException对象来获取异常信息。下面是一个示例代码,演示如何使用try-catch块来处理异常:tryresult = 10 / 0; % 这里会引发除零异常catch MEdisp('发生

    2024-04-07
    0

发表回复

登录后才能评论